Choosing a safe vape device requires attention to several key factors. Look for devices that have built-in safety features. Overheating protection and short-circuit prevention are essential. These features can significantly reduce the risk of accidents. Additionally, a regulated device can help control the voltage and wattage, providing a more stable experience.
Check the materials used in construction. Stainless steel and other high-quality alloys are preferable. Avoid devices made from low-grade plastics. These may leach harmful chemicals when heated. A device with a tempered glass tank offers added safety as well. Glass is less likely to break and leak than plastic. Battery safety is another critical aspect. Select devices that support high-quality, certified batteries. Always follow the manufacturer's guidelines for battery care and usage.
Seek out reviews from credible sources. User feedback can provide insight into real-world performance and safety. Remember, not all devices marketed as "safe" are thoroughly tested. When choosing a vape device, it's crucial to recognize warning signs of unsafe products. A poorly constructed vape can lead to serious health risks. Check for manufacturing defects, such as cracks or unusual noises during operation. If a device feels too hot or leaks, these are red flags. Trust your instincts; if something seems off, it probably is.
Another important aspect is to inspect the battery. A faulty battery can cause explosions or malfunctions. Look for safety certifications and avoid devices that lack this. Keep an eye out for strange smells during charging. This can indicate overheating. Always use a charger recommended by the manufacturer. Using a cheap charger might save money now but could cost you later.
User reviews can provide insight into a device's safety. Look for feedback about battery life and overall performance. If many users report issues, consider that a warning. Safety should never be an afterthought. Regular maintenance, like cleaning the device, is essential. A neglected vape may not only perform poorly but also pose risks.
